Output 95733265aba1e4033174e0c31fa09bf3b489d0453c8d4b4bd6cdf753c0d0e3c2:1

value
618501422938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 deddb83518ed5d4d9efa38fe0ce1824a1cc06b52 OP_EQUALVERIFY OP_CHECKSIG
address
DRTWABy7EmWwbWMVBMe3bpiJKftyRLoHis
transaction
95733265aba1e4033174e0c31fa09bf3b489d0453c8d4b4bd6cdf753c0d0e3c2